The Substantial Shell out Centre, which done the most current analysis into boardroom shell out, stated the normal chief government nevertheless gained 86 times a lot more than the median earnings for normal Uk workers previous 12 months.
The team extra that 9 companies which tapped into taxpayer dollars as a result of the Government’s furlough scheme also paid their CEOs an normal of £2.2m.
Government shell out has occur into target in the course of the pandemic, with hundreds of thousands of workers furloughed or experiencing an unsure long term, and some companies struggling an unprecedented hit to revenues and income.
Some activists and politicians have argued that bosses of companies that tapped up govt assistance schemes ought to not subsequently get seven-figure salaries and bonuses.
